Skip to content

feat: add UPS monitoring integration using nut-client

8182769
Select commit
Loading
Failed to load commit list.
Open

feat: add NUT (Network UPS Tools) integration base #126

feat: add UPS monitoring integration using nut-client
8182769
Select commit
Loading
Failed to load commit list.
SonarQubeCloud / SonarCloud Code Analysis succeeded Mar 9, 2026 in 29s

Annotations

Check warning on line 13 in src/api/infra/nut/NutManager.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Prefer `Number.parseInt` over `parseInt`.

See more on https://sonarcloud.io/project/issues?id=project-SIMPLE_simple.webplatform&issues=AZzR2ej8nXc0p40jpcPa&open=AZzR2ej8nXc0p40jpcPa&pullRequest=126

Check warning on line 104 in src/api/infra/nut/NutManager.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Complete the task associated to this "TODO" comment.

See more on https://sonarcloud.io/project/issues?id=project-SIMPLE_simple.webplatform&issues=AZzR2ej8nXc0p40jpcPd&open=AZzR2ej8nXc0p40jpcPd&pullRequest=126

Check warning on line 89 in src/api/infra/nut/NutManager.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Complete the task associated to this "TODO" comment.

See more on https://sonarcloud.io/project/issues?id=project-SIMPLE_simple.webplatform&issues=AZzR2ej8nXc0p40jpcPb&open=AZzR2ej8nXc0p40jpcPb&pullRequest=126

Check warning on line 9 in src/api/infra/nut/NutManager.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Member 'upsName' is never reassigned; mark it as `readonly`.

See more on https://sonarcloud.io/project/issues?id=project-SIMPLE_simple.webplatform&issues=AZzR2ej8nXc0p40jpcPZ&open=AZzR2ej8nXc0p40jpcPZ&pullRequest=126

Check warning on line 97 in src/api/infra/nut/NutManager.ts

See this annotation in the file changed.

@sonarqubecloud sonarqubecloud / SonarCloud Code Analysis

Complete the task associated to this "TODO" comment.

See more on https://sonarcloud.io/project/issues?id=project-SIMPLE_simple.webplatform&issues=AZzR2ej8nXc0p40jpcPc&open=AZzR2ej8nXc0p40jpcPc&pullRequest=126